Assistant Controller
On-siteCharlotte, North Carolina, United States
Job Summary
Oversee day-to-day accounting operations, including accounts payable, accounts receivable, payroll, and general ledger activities. Review journal entries, account reconciliations, and financial transactions while assisting with the preparation of monthly financial statements and management reports. Manage the month-end and year-end close processes, coordinate annual audits, and support subcontractor payment workflows. Assist with budgeting, forecasting, and cash flow management, and identify process improvements for implementation. Ensure compliance with GAAP and organizational policies while training and mentoring accounting staff. This exempt position reports to the Chief Financial Officer and requires 5+ years of progressive accounting experience, including preferred construction and public accounting backgrounds.
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years of progressive accounting experience
-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, or related field
- Strong knowledge of GAAP and financial reporting
- Strong attention to detail and accuracy
- Excellent problem solving and communication sk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and accounting software
Desired Qualifications
- Public accounting experience preferred
- Construction accounting experience preferred
- CPA or CPA candidate preferred
